My name is Leigh and I write on behalf of my husband who has been a solar city customer since 2012.
I write this complaint to inform solar city that their company, representatives, and service have been dismal and frustrating. I would never recommend this company to anyone, and truly believe this company has failed in many respects. I normally positive things on company websites, but I have had to post a negative rating before for solar city in order to even receive a call back from the representatives or company.

I write n behalf of my husband because he is so frustrated with the service; he no longer wants to communicate with a company who does not communicate with him. I have recently married him and when I came to live in his house after selling my home which I adored, I noticed he had solar on his roof (neither here nor there, one of my complaints is that he is solar is hideous looking on his roof--I have known many other solar companies and clients who are happy with the positioning of the solar panels on their roofs--the solar panels on my husband's roof are positioned to actually be an eyes sore to the aesthetic appeal of his house--not to say that during wind storms, we are concerned that the panels may raise off the roof causing more damage than what I will cite later on this complaint).

My grievance is with the efficiency and speed that this company takes to do business with customers. The first part of this long complaint, which is actually situations and problems compiled on top of one another, is that when my husband first sought out putting the solar city product on his roof, it took 1 whole year in which to have the panels installed. I have heard of wait times due to city ordinances, but to wait a year to even hear back from the solar city folks regarding installation is not acceptable.

When the solar panels where installed, they were not installed properly. MY husband is a general contractor and he has installed roofs on many homes he has built and refurbished. When the solar city employees were up on his roof, they were stomping loudly, jumping from elevation changes on his roof and they left gaping holes where the panels attached to his roof. He told the employees about it on the spot and he was dismissed. When he put a grievance in with the company, he was dismissed as well. One night soon after installation, it rained. He awoke to a large amount of water on his living room floor as well as water leaking from the ceiling where the panels had been installed. He promptly called Solar City back and although they came back, they never correctly repaired the leaks or patched the holes with the proper roofing material.

This roofing fiasco not quite taken care of, my husband would periodically call solar city and explain his problem. Finally as I came to the picture, I decided enough was enough. I thought that either Solar City should fix the problem or they could come and remove their panels. I wrote a complaint letter such like this and left it on the solar city board, which I will do with this as well, in August of 2015. We finally received a call back that week from a solar city representative. The next week he scheduled with my husband to come out to his property to assess the damage.

The representative came and agreed with us that the patches on the roof needed repair, that the inside of the ceilings needed repair and repaint, and that the company was responsible and should pay. For a while in late summer of last year of 2015, solar city representatives seemed to finally get on the ball and try to rectify the situation.

However, late in 2015, the communication became less and less. The company informed my husband that they would pay, but pay a roofer directly. We had no idea why they did not just give my husband a check for the problems so he could fix them. This left my husband with scrambling around to find a roofer he felt comfortable with, that would give a decent quote and that Solar City would give a check to.

As this was going on, my husband also noticed his electric bill began to have problems. For the entire history of the solar panels being attacked to his roof, he only had to pay the panel rental fee. He never had to pay an electric bill and he was constantly credited with his conserving energy use. However in late 2015, my husband noticed his energy bill credits decreased monthly to the point where in 2016, he began paying an 11 dollar bill to his electric company. After calling his electric biller, he was informed that the rate basis in which the electric company paid him had changed. The electric company had changed how it credited unused and sold back electric power from a 1:1 rate exchange to a prorated to commercial exchange, which effectively dwindled his credits and caused him to start paying an electric bill. This, I’m not sure if solar city has any part in changing, especially since we use LESS energy and sell back MORE and still are charged.

The final straw to me has come during this year. Roofers that solar city paid part monies due for repairing my husband’s roof came on the exact day my husband was in the hospital for a minor outpatient procedure. They came without notice, and without Solar City nor the company warning or setting up a date with my husband. Furthermore, communication during this year with the company truly lacked--after trying to reschedule the roofing company, we never heard back from solar city regarding any other roofing repairs. Although a painter came to repair his ceiling and repaint it, some repaint was unacceptable and my husband requested a painter to come back to repaint which never happened.

My husband is at an impasse. I want nothing more than to rid ourselves of the monstrosity on his roof. They look aesthetically hideous, they are somewhat dangerous during wind sto5rms, they are not worth the money anymore, and the roof and ceiling repairs have not been completed, and were not up to par during repairs or installation. I stopped by a solar city representative in a big box store who said he would alert his internal folks to at least call my husband to complete this long standing problem but I take no stock that that will happen.
The company's communication record with us is absurd. if I had to write a scathing compliant letter just to get representatives out to look at his panels before, and communication has ceased again, I’m not sure what I will have to do now to get repairs, funds and just some attention paid to my husband’s roof and panels this time.
Bottom line--my husband and I are extremely dissatisfied with company's poor service, attention to detail, help to the customer and overall workmanship. I think I could have hired beginners to place panels on a flat roof and had a better outcome than this. I would never, and I truly mean never refer this company to anyone. I work for the government and I know if give service like this to my veterans, some of them will die waiting for care, or receiving shoddy and improper care. I do not doubt that others have had success with this company but our disappointments, problems and continued frustration with this company outweighs any positivity I hear. I really want the panels removed and solar city deserves no more money from husband because they do not give any service that warrants such money being paid to them.
